Box Score HOUGHTON, N.Y. — The Keuka College Women's Soccer team earned their first Empire 8 Conference victory on Saturday, winning on the road at Houghton College 3-0.
Lindsey Garbacz scored the first goal for Keuka College (2-10-2, 1-4-1 Empire 8) and it proved to be the game-winner. Grace DeCapua and Peyton Miller added goals for the Wolves in the win.
Keuka College 3 at Houghton College 0
The hosts started fast with an early corner 68 seconds into the game on Saturday. Houghton College had a pair of shots in the opening 10 minutes of play, but senior keeper Jessica Pegg was there for the saves. The Wolves pulled ahead in the 17th minute as Garbacz found the back of the net to make it 1-0 Keuka. The Highlanders had only one other shot in the first, but it went high of the net as Keuka controlled the play. Grace DeCapua scored her team-leading fourth goal of the year on 36 minutes as Keuka College led 2-0 at the half.
It was an evenly played second half with Keuka holding a slight edge, 7-5, in shots and each team had a pair of corners. Peyton Miller put the game away in the 57th as she collected the ball off a Carli Zollo shot and put it in the back of the net for the 3-0 lead. The Green and Gold would see the game out for their first Empire 8 Conference victory
KC Notes:
- Keuka College improves to 4-5-1 all-time against Houghton College. It is Keuka's first win against Houghton since the 1988 season
- Saturday was Keuka's first conference win as a member of the Empire 8
- Jessica Pegg got the win in goal for the Wolves. The senior made five saves and moved into second on the career wins list at Keuka College with 27
